GeForce GTX 650 Ti Zotac 1GB Edition Game Requirement Analysis
GeForce GTX 650 Ti Zotac 1GB Edition is a special edition of the fast-middle-class GeForce GTX 650 Ti.
This edition features a new and better cooling system and an increase in the central clock that went from 928MHz to 941MHz.
The overclocking is only slightly and benchmarks indicate there's a 1% boost when compared to the reference GeForce GTX 650 Ti.
